Businesses in 2026 demand real-time data, compliance tracking, and automation across finance, inventory, HR, and operations. They want one system, not multiple tools. ERP is no longer optional. It is the backbone of growth and investor readiness.
Large systems like SAP ERP and Oracle ERP are powerful but expensive for mid-sized firms. This creates a market gap. A white-label ERP platform delivers faster deployment, lower cost, and flexible pricing suited for growing companies.
Most IT consultants depend on project billing. Once deployment ends, revenue stops. Clients negotiate rates and compare vendors. Cash flow becomes unstable. Scaling requires hiring more engineers, which increases fixed cost.
Consultants also lack product ownership. You implement external tools but do not control pricing or roadmap. When vendors raise fees, your margin shrinks. This blocks long-term enterprise value creation.

The SaaS ERP model includes $10, $25, and $50 tiers. The $10 plan fits micro firms. The $25 plan supports growing companies. The $50 plan includes advanced modules and API access for enterprises.
This tier system allows natural upselling. As clients expand, they move upward. Recurring billing compounds monthly. With 200 active clients, revenue becomes stable and scalable.
Partners earn 20% to 40% margin on subscriptions. If 150 clients pay an average of $25, monthly billing is $3,750. At 30% margin, you earn $1,125 recurring income, excluding services.
